Transponder keys are more secure that traditional keys but they can still be stolen. However, it is important to keep in mind that transponder key are not functional without proper programing. These keys require a specific radio signal from the car's ignition switch. It is important to know that the new key must slide into the ignition switch and then turn to transmit the correct signal to the transponder. Contrary to conventional keys, transponder keys do not require batteries to operate. Instead the radio signal provides the electrical power for the transponder. The radio receiver contains an electronic capacitor that provides the electrical power.
